Why Knowing Your Aquarium's Exact Volume Matters
Numerous newbie aquarists make the error of assuming their tank holds the precise amount of water marketed on the box. For instance, a "55-gallon tank" rarely holds a full 55 gallons of water when substrate, driftwood, rocks, and devices are included.
Here are the primary reasons that computing the real net water volume is important:
Accurate Medication Dosing: Under-dosing can render treatments inadequate, enabling illness to continue. Over-dosing can toxin delicate fish, invertebrates, and live plants.Correct Stocking Levels: The timeless "one inch of fish per gallon" guideline is greatly flawed, however understanding the precise water volume assists aquarists follow trustworthy bio-load guidelines (such as the AqAdvisor calculator).Water Conditioner and Additives: Dechlorinators, pH adjusters, and micronutrient need to be measured precisely based upon the volume of water being treated during water modifications.Fertilizer Regimens: In planted tanks, calculating water volume makes sure that macro and micro-nutrients are supplied at optimum levels without triggering algae flowers.Basic Aquarium Shapes and Formulas
Calculating volume depends completely on the geometry of the tank. Below are the basic mathematical formulas utilized in an aquarium volume calculator to determine overall capability in both gallons and liters.
1. Rectangular Aquariums
The most common and straightforward tank shape. To discover the volume, measure the interior length, width, and height.
Formula (Inches): ₤ \ text Volume (Gallons) = \ frac \ text Length \ times \ text Width \ times \ text Height 231 ₤Formula (Centimeters): ₤ \ text Volume (Liters) = \ frac \ text Length \ times \ text Width \ times \ text Height 1000 ₤2. Bow-Front Aquariums
Bow-front tanks include a curved front glass that broadens the viewing area. Because of the curve, basic rectangular formulas will overestimate the volume.
Approximation Formula (Inches): ₤ \ text Volume (Gallons) = \ frac \ text Length \ times (\ text Width + \ text Optimum Depth) \ div 2 \ times \ text Height 231 ₤3. Cylinder Aquariums
Cylindrical tanks use a distinct 360-degree viewing experience. The formula relies on the radius (half of the diameter) and the height.
Formula (Inches): ₤ \ text Volume (Gallons) = \ frac \ pi \ times \ text radius ^ 2 \ times \ text Height 231 ₤ (Note: ₤ \ pi \ approx 3.1416 ₤)4. Hexagonal Aquariums
Hexagonal tanks have six sides. While computing the area of a regular hexagon can be complex, aquarists can utilize a streamlined evaluation formula based on the range in between opposite flat sides (the brief diameter).
Approximation Formula (Inches): ₤ \ text Volume (Gallons) = \ text Brief Diameter \ times \ text Long Width \ times \ text Height \ times 0.432 ₤ (Rough quote)Quick Reference Table: Standard Tank Sizes
To give aquarists a quick baseline, the table listed below outlines standard tank dimensions alongside their optimum theoretical capabilities and estimated net volumes (accounting for substrate and hardscape).
Tank Type/ SizeMeasurements (L x W x H in inches)Max Capacity (Gallons)Estimated Net Volume (Gallons)Standard 10 Gallon20" x 10" x 12"10.48.5-- 9Requirement 20 Gallon Long30" x 12" x 12"18.716-- 17Standard 29 Gallon30" x 12" x 18"28.124-- 25Standard 40 Gallon Breeder36" x 18" x 16"44.938-- 40Basic 55 Gallon48" x 13" x 21"58.148-- 50Requirement 75 Gallon48" x 18" x 21"80.568-- 72Standard 90 Gallon48" x 18" x 24"92.078-- 82Standard 125 Gallon72" x 18" x 22"124.6105-- 115
Note: Calculations utilize interior measurements where possible, however actual glass density and cut can alter the final numbers slightly.
Gross Volume vs. Net Volume: What's the Difference?
Comprehending the distinction in between gross and net volume is critical for any major fishkeeper.
Gross Volume: This is the overall geometric capacity of the empty tank. If water were filled totally to the absolute brim, this is what the tank would hold.Net Volume: This is the actual quantity of water present in the system throughout regular operation.Elements That Reduce Net Water Volume
When determining just how much water is genuinely in an aquarium, several displacement elements should be subtracted from the gross volume:
Substrate: Gravel, sand, and aqusoil take up considerable area. A 2-inch layer of substrate in a 55-gallon tank can easily displace 5 to 7 gallons of water.Hardscape: Large pieces of driftwood, lava rock, dragon stone, and slate displace water proportional to their mass.The Water Line: Aquariums are rarely filled to the absolute edge. A basic clearance of 1 inch at the top for surface area agitation and equipment prevents Fish Tank Capacity Calculator from leaping out, but decreases total water volume.3D Backgrounds and Internal Filters: Silicone-bonded 3D foam backgrounds or big internal filter boxes displace an unexpected quantity of water.Step-by-Step Guide: How to Measure an Irregular Tank
For custom-built tanks, corner units, or uncommon shapes that do not fit standard mathematical designs, manual measurement is needed.
Action 1: Measure Interior Dimensions. Constantly determine the inside of the tank instead of the exterior. Measuring the outside includes the density of the glass, which will artificially pump up the volume estimation.Action 2: Convert to Inches or Centimeters. For gallons, procedure in inches. For liters, procedure in centimeters.Action 3: Apply the Appropriate Formula. Divide the cubic measurement by the conversion aspect (231 for United States Gallons, 1,000 for Liters).Step 4: Account for Displacement. Use the container method throughout the initial fill to find the precise net volume.The Bucket Method (The Most Accurate Technique)
For outright precision, specifically in intricate aquascapes, utilize the pail method:
Use a significant bucket or container of a known volume (e.g., a 1-gallon or 5-gallon pail).Fill the tank gradually using just determined pails of water.Keep a tally of every pail included till the tank reaches its regular operating water level.The final tally equals the exact net water volume of the system.Best Practices for Tank Maintenance Based on Volume
Once the specific water volume is established, keeping the aquarium ends up being far more methodical.
Water Change Calculations: Most enthusiasts go for a 20% to 30% weekly water modification. Understanding the exact net volume makes sure that the appropriate amount of old water is eliminated and changed, which the proper dose of water conditioner is added for just the new water being introduced.Medication Protocols: Always calculate medication dosages based on the net volume (minus substrate and hardscape), not the manufacturer's nominal tank size. Over-medicating is a leading cause of unexpected Fish Tank Volume Calculator Gallons loss during treatments.Chemical Additives: Keep a composed record of the tank's net volume taped inside the Aquarium Tank Calculator cabinet for fast recommendation throughout routine maintenance.
